Is JESSIE HOWARD TURNER safe to work with?

Is JESSIE HOWARD TURNER safe to load? JESSIE HOWARD TURNER (USDOT 3568277) is an active small-fleet motor carrier based in LOGAN, AL, operating 8 power units and 8 drivers. Operating authority has been active 5 years (past the 24-month broker-confidence threshold). Across 21 roadside inspections, its vehicle out-of-service rate is 54.5% (above the 22.26% national average), with 1 reportable crash in the last 24 months. FMCSA has not assigned a safety rating. Vektor rates it clear to load (86/100), with the leading concern: vehicle out-of-service rate well above average. Source: FMCSA SAFER/MCMIS, last updated 2026-06-13.
